Population Overview

Bedminster CDP is a small community located in New Jersey. The total population is 1,463. It ranks as the 515th most populous out of 700 cities and towns in New Jersey.

Age Demographics

The median age in Bedminster CDP is 43.8 years. This is 9% higher than the state median of 40.1 years.

Economy, Income & Housing

The median household income in Bedminster CDP is $123,289. This is 22% higher than the state median of $101,050. Compared to the national median of $78,538, household income here is 57% higher. The poverty rate stands at 2.5%. This is 74% lower than the state poverty rate of 9.8%. This exceptionally low poverty rate indicates strong economic prosperity across the community. The unemployment rate is 5.5%. This is 12% lower than the state rate of 6.2%. The median home value is $830,800. Housing costs are 94% higher than the state median of $427,600. The home-value-to-income ratio of 6.7x suggests that housing affordability is a significant concern for many residents. 71.2% of occupied housing units are owner-occupied. This homeownership rate is 12% higher than the state average of 63.7%.

Race & Ethnicity

The largest racial or ethnic group in Bedminster CDP is White (non-Hispanic), making up 68.5% of the population. Hispanic or Latino residents account for 24.0%. The Black or African American population (1.1%) is well below the state average of 12.3%.

Education

57.4% of residents aged 25 and older hold a bachelor's degree or higher. This is 34% higher than the state rate of 42.9%. Nationally, 35.0% of adults hold at least a bachelor's degree. The high school graduation rate (or equivalent) is 92.6%. Notably, 24.4% of adults hold a graduate or professional degree, indicating a highly educated workforce.

Data Sources & Methodology

All demographic data for Bedminster CDP, New Jersey is sourced from the U.S. Census Bureau's American Community Survey (ACS) 5-Year Estimates (2019-2023). The ACS collects data from approximately 3.5 million households annually, providing reliable estimates for communities of all sizes. Comparisons are made against New Jersey state averages and national averages calculated from the same dataset. Rankings reflect the city's position among all 700 Census-designated places in New Jersey. For official data, visit data.census.gov.
